Puppy Linux Discussion Forum Forum Index Puppy Linux Discussion Forum
Puppy HOME page : puppylinux.com
"THE" alternative forum : puppylinux.info
 
 FAQFAQ   SearchSearch   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

The time now is Fri 28 Nov 2014, 05:50
All times are UTC - 4
 Forum index » Advanced Topics » Additional Software (PETs, n' stuff) » Graphics
TexTex - Latex plugin for inkscape
Post new topic   Reply to topic View previous topic :: View next topic
Page 1 of 1 [1 Post]  
Author Message
darkcity


Joined: 23 May 2010
Posts: 2479
Location: near here

PostPosted: Sat 07 Sep 2013, 08:07    Post subject:  TexTex - Latex plugin for inkscape  

TexTex - Latex plugin for Inkscape. The Latex script can be modified after being inserted (ie it isn't a one way process).
http://pav.iki.fi/software/textext/

Requirements-

python-2.6-lxmlnumpy-cut-i486.pet http://murga-linux.com/puppy/viewtopic.php?t=73176 (general for Inkscape plugins)

Python+-2.6.4-i486.pet http://www.murga-linux.com/puppy/viewtopic.php?t=49138 (for pygtk)

pdf2svg-0.2.2-i486.pet http://puppylinuxstuff.meownplanet.net/darkcity/packages/pdf2svg-0.2.2-i486.pet

TexText-0.4.4.pet http://puppylinuxstuff.meownplanet.net/darkcity/packages/TexText-0.4.4.pet (the plugin)

Ensure a Latex system is installed - check using latex -v and pdflatex -v

For example the texlive-2011-FULLAPP.sfs http://www.murga-linux.com/puppy/viewtopic.php?p=590288#590288


Requires library libpoppler.so.13 or later.
Make a link called libpoppler.so.13 to the latest libpoppler.
For example in Slacko 5.6 make a relative symlink called libpoppler.so.13 to /usr/lib/libpoppler.so.26.0.0

---
error examples

no pdflatex command present-
Quote:
Traceback (most recent call last):
File "textext.py", line 210, in cb_ok
self.callback(self.text, self.preamble_file, self.scale_factor)
File "textext.py", line 369, in <lambda>
converter_cls, old_node))
File "textext.py", line 387, in do_convert
new_node = converter.convert(text, preamble_file, scale_factor)
File "textext.py", line 875, in convert
return PdfConverterBase.convert(self, *a, **kw)
File "textext.py", line 750, in convert
self.tex_to_pdf(latex_text, preamble_file)
File "textext.py", line 727, in tex_to_pdf
exec_command(['pdflatex', self.tmp('tex')] + latexOpts)
File "textext.py", line 592, in exec_command
raise RuntimeError("Command %s failed: %s" % (' '.join(cmd), e))
RuntimeError: Command pdflatex /tmp/tmp86l_b3/tmp.tex -interaction=nonstopmode -halt-on-error failed: [Errno 2] No such file or directory


The Latex interpreter is quite fussy, expect long error if it doesn't like something-
Quote:
Traceback (most recent call last):
File "textext.py", line 210, in cb_ok
self.callback(self.text, self.preamble_file, self.scale_factor)
File "textext.py", line 369, in <lambda>
converter_cls, old_node))
File "textext.py", line 387, in do_convert
new_node = converter.convert(text, preamble_file, scale_factor)
File "textext.py", line 875, in convert
return PdfConverterBase.convert(self, *a, **kw)
File "textext.py", line 750, in convert
self.tex_to_pdf(latex_text, preamble_file)
File "textext.py", line 727, in tex_to_pdf
exec_command(['pdflatex', self.tmp('tex')] + latexOpts)
File "textext.py", line 596, in exec_command
% (' '.join(cmd), p.returncode, out + err))
RuntimeError: Command pdflatex /tmp/tmpUmfIz9/tmp.tex -interaction=nonstopmode -halt-on-error failed (code 1): This is pdfTeX, Version 3.1415926-2.3-1.40.12 (TeX Live 2011)
restricted \write18 enabled.
entering extended mode
(/tmp/tmpUmfIz9/tmp.tex
LaTeX2e <2009/09/24>
Babel <v3.8l> and hyphenation patterns for english, dumylang, nohyphenation, ge
rman-x-2009-06-19, ngerman-x-2009-06-19, afrikaans, ancientgreek, ibycus, arabi
c, armenian, basque, bulgarian, catalan, pinyin, coptic, croatian, czech, danis
h, dutch, ukenglish, usenglishmax, esperanto, estonian, ethiopic, farsi, finnis
h, french, galician, german, ngerman, swissgerman, monogreek, greek, hungarian,
icelandic, assamese, bengali, gujarati, hindi, kannada, malayalam, marathi, or
iya, panjabi, tamil, telugu, indonesian, interlingua, irish, italian, kurmanji,
lao, latin, latvian, lithuanian, mongolian, mongolianlmc, bokmal, nynorsk, pol
ish, portuguese, romanian, russian, sanskrit, serbian, serbianc, slovak, sloven
ian, spanish, swedish, turkish, turkmen, ukrainian, uppersorbian, welsh, loaded
.
(/usr/local/texlive/2011/texmf-dist/tex/latex/base/article.cls
Document Class: article 2007/10/19 v1.4h Standard LaTeX document class
(/usr/local/texlive/2011/texmf-dist/tex/latex/base/size10.clo))

LaTeX Warning: Unused global option(s):
[a0].

No file tmp.aux.
! Missing $ inserted.
<inserted text>
$
l.7 \cos
A \cos B &= \frac{1}{2}\left[ \cos(A-B)+\cos(A+B) \right] \\
?
! Emergency stop.
<inserted text>
$
l.7 \cos
A \cos B &= \frac{1}{2}\left[ \cos(A-B)+\cos(A+B) \right] \\
! ==> Fatal error occurred, no output PDF file produced!
Transcript written on tmp.log.


May require reboot after everything's installed.

Also see wiki page http://puppylinux.org/wikka/TexText
exampletextex.png
 Description   
 Filesize   36.98 KB
 Viewed   648 Time(s)

exampletextex.png


_________________
helping Wiki for help | IF SendSpace link = "dead" THEN PM me ("up file to http://meownplanet.net/")
Back to top
View user's profile Send private message Visit poster's website 
Display posts from previous:   Sort by:   
Page 1 of 1 [1 Post]  
Post new topic   Reply to topic View previous topic :: View next topic
 Forum index » Advanced Topics » Additional Software (PETs, n' stuff) » Graphics
Jump to:  

You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um
You cannot attach files in this forum
You can download files in this forum


Powered by phpBB © 2001, 2005 phpBB Group
[ Time: 0.0511s ][ Queries: 12 (0.0046s) ][ GZIP on ]